The Indiana House Republican Caucus released a draft Monday of the state’s new congressional district map — just five hours before the body met to consider adoption of the proposal. As expected, the new map is contrived to dilute Black and brown communities in Marion and Lake counties.
So much for perfection — which is what the 2021 map was called by Republican leaders. If passed this week, the Senate should refuse to ratify this appalling plan that even well-established Republicans like former Gov. Mitch Daniels called distasteful and anti-democratic.
